Body

Origins and Family

Princess Adityadhornkitikhun of Thailand was born in Bangkok[2]. She was born on +1984-05-05T00:00:00Z[3]. Her father was Virayudh Tishyasarin[7]. Her mother was Chulabhorn, Princess Srisavangavadhana[8]. She is identified as part of the Thai people ethnic group[11]. Thai was her native language[10].

Education

Educated at Chitralada School[12], a school[28], in Thailand[29]; The Art Institute of Washington[13], an art academy[30], in United States[31], founded in 2000[32]; The Art Institute of California – San Diego[14], an art academy[33], in United States[34], founded in 1981[35]; and Mahidol University International College[15], an academic institution[36], in Thailand[37], founded in 1986[38].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include painter[4] and designer[5].

Personal Life

Religious affiliations include Buddhism[16], a religion[39] and Theravāda[17], a religious denomination[40].
